Originally Posted by inanimate_object' post='872894' date='May 24 2007, 02:43 AM

Why do you think catholics can't believe in dinosaurs? They're mentioned in the bible at the end of Job, and there's a whole bunch of references to dragons. It's also arguable that the bible supports an old earth (15bn year) point of view, it certainly doesn't contradict it.

O Rly?



Fall of Jerusalem (as archeologically supported)...

588 B.C.



Ezekiel 4:4-7

Fall of jerusalem is prophesized to be 430 years after division of Solomon's kingdom...

1018 B.C.



From the end of Solomon's 40-year reign to the start of the Temple in the 4th year of his reign takes us back to...

1055 B.C.



1 Kings 6:1

Solomon's temple started 480 years after Exodus from Egypt...

1534 B.C



Gen 12:10/Exodus 12:40/Gal 3:17

Abraham enters Canaan 430 years before Exodus from Egypt...

1964 B.C.

Since Abraham entered Canaan at age 75 (Gen 12:4), he was born approximately 2039 B.C.



Gen 11:11-26

Arpachshad(Abrahams grandad and Noah's son) born 290 years after Abraham, and 2 years after the flood,

2331 B.C.



Genesis 5:3-32

1656 years between creation and the flood (explicitly)

3987 B.C.



Either the dating of the ruins of Jerusalem are off by a few billion years, or creation week was in 3987 B.C., which makes the world just barely 6000 years old.
